The ingredients needed to make Jerk chicken:
  1. Take dry rub
  2. Take 2 scoth bonnet peppers, chopped
  3. Prepare 2 clove garlic, chopped
  4. Make ready 2 stick scallions, chopped
  5. Get 2 tbsp fresh thyme, chopped
  6. Take 1 1/2 tsp ground cloves
  7. Get 1 1/2 tsp ground cinnamon
  8. Get 1 1/2 tsp allspice
  9. Get 1 tsp salt
  10. Take 1/2 tsp black pepper
  11. Prepare chicken
  12. Get 3 lb chicken legs and thighs
  13. Make ready 2 tbsp olive oil
  14. Get 2 tbsp worcestershire sauce
Instructions to make Jerk chicken:
  1. Preheat oven to 425°F.
  2. Mix the dry rub ingredients together. Score chicken on skin side. Apply dry rub to chicken.
  3. In a dutch oven heat olive oil and then add chicken. Cook and brown chicken for about 10 minutes. Add worcestershire sauce and stir.
  4. Cover chicken and place in oven. Cook for about 20 minutes.
  5. Serve.
